    Circle Inversion

    Alternate name
    Definition

    The inverse curve of the circle with parametric equations x | = | a cos t y | = | a sin t with respect to an inversion circle with center (x, y) and radius R is given by x_i | = | x_0 + (R(a cos t - x_0))/((x_0 - a cos t)^2 + (y_0 - a sin t)^2) y_i | = | y_0 + (R(a sin t - y_0))/((x_0 - a cos t)^2 + (y_0 - a sin t)^2), which is another circle.
